I was looking forward to my first time at O'Reillys. First, the good: The building is gorgeous inside and out. The appetizers (ordered the beets and the croquettes) were both good. Decent wine list. Now, everything else: The water glasses smelled like sanitizer, rendering the Pelligrino worse than tap. Both water glasses and their replacements had lipstick on them. Cut lime for the water was old and dry. The bread was stale and had been cut hours earlier. The waitress never noticed empty wine glasses. The presentation on the pollack was so bad it almost appeared to have been eaten once already. I've never had a more surprisingly bad dining experience in SF.
